Output 86f5613e541a89caa7a56f70c1e618b5ef629605cbaeaae7f5404470f51abbce:1

value
551601
script pubkey
OP_0 OP_PUSHBYTES_20 ec57800cdfe76fd4edbc77f6633a38526accfbce
address
bc1qa3tcqrxluahafmduwlmxxw3c2f4ve77wz0pwkp
transaction
86f5613e541a89caa7a56f70c1e618b5ef629605cbaeaae7f5404470f51abbce
spent
true